What to Pack for Your Tent Camping Trip
When packing for your tent camping trip to Eureka Springs, it’s essential to be prepared for various weather conditions and activities. Here’s a list of essential items to bring:
- Tent: Choose a tent that is suitable for the number of people in your group and the weather conditions.
- Sleeping Bags and Pads: Make sure your sleeping bags are comfortable and suitable for the expected temperatures.
- Food and Cooking Supplies: Pack non-perishable food items, a portable stove, and cooking utensils.
- Water and Hydration: Bring plenty of water for drinking and cooking, as well as a water purification system.
- First Aid Kit: Include bandages, antiseptic wipes, pain relievers, and any personal medications.
- Clothing: Dress in layers, as temperatures can vary throughout the day. Don’t forget rain gear and sun protection.
- Outdoor Gear: Depending on your activities, bring hiking boots, fishing gear, or other necessary equipment.
